Hello,
I'm creating a configuration for a board that uses an AT91RM9200
and I'm getting unresolved linker errors concerning the i2c functions
(i2c_write/read/probe/init).
I know that the I2C peripheral for this SoC is buggy and am looking for
a GPIO bus option - does this exist in u-boot, or do I need to add one?

>you will find such a configuration in :
http://git.denx.de/?p=u-boot.git;a=blob;f=include/configs/cpuat91.h;h=1b43c54f486bec0a27b478cc3de2ba64be8692b5;hb=HEAD
around line 104
